As part of the Databricks Payroll team, you will join a dynamic global organisation that is helping our customers solve some of their toughest problems. You will also ensure our employees are paid accurately, on time, and in compliance with all requirements—allowing them to focus on doing their best work. This role is ideal for a payroll professional who loves hands-on processing, thrives on problem-solving, and brings strong systems skills to handle complex payroll cases without escalation.
The Senior Payroll Analyst will work closely with the Payroll Director to support accurate and timely payroll processing for our Asia region—specifically Australia, Korea, Japan & Singapore, this may change as per org need and design. You will collaborate with payroll vendors, internal partners, and employees to deliver compliant, efficient payroll operations. While you will not be solely responsible for payroll execution, you will play a key role in preparing, validating, and reconciling payroll data, responding to employee inquiries, and supporting projects and process improvements.
This role reports to the Payroll Director based in UK.
The impact you will have:
- Payroll processing support – Partner with the Payroll Analyst team in India to prepare, validate, and reconcile payroll data for the countries specified above or as per org design, ensuring accuracy, compliance, and timely delivery.
- Data validation & audits – Perform pre- and post-processing checks to identify and resolve discrepancies before payroll is finalized.
- Vendor collaboration – Work closely with payroll vendors to troubleshoot issues, resolve variances, and meet Service Level Agreements (SLAs).
- Compliance adherence – Ensure payroll operations follow internal controls, statutory regulations, and company policies for each country.
- Employee case resolution – Respond to and resolve payroll inquiries through the case management tool, providing accurate and timely support.
- Process improvement – Identify and recommend scalable solutions to enhance payroll efficiency and accuracy.
- Documentation maintenance – Develop and update payroll process documentation to support consistency and knowledge sharing.
- Project participation – Contribute to payroll-related projects, system enhancements, and testing activities in the ASIA region.
What we look for:
- Regional payroll expertise – 5-7 years of payroll processing experience in Asia region.
- Global Team Environment - experience working for a multinational and high-growth company.
- Regulatory knowledge – Solid understanding of statutory payroll requirements, including taxes, social security, and government reporting for each supported country.
- System proficiency – Experience with Workday Payroll or a similar HRIS/payroll system, with the ability to learn and adapt to new technologies quickly.
- Analytical & technical skills – Intermediate Excel skills (Pivot Tables, VLOOKUPs, formulas) and the ability to analyze and reconcile payroll data for accuracy.
- Case management experience – Familiarity with case management tools, SLAs, and metrics to track and improve service delivery.
- Language skills – Fluency in English and Spanish; Portuguese is a strong plus.
- Collaboration & communication – Proven ability to work effectively with cross-functional partners in HR, Finance, and external vendors.

About the company
Databricks
Large Enterprise
Databricks is a cloud-based data platform that specializes in providing solutions for data engineering, machine learning, and analytics. Founded in 2013 by the original creators of Apache Spark, the company enables organizations to unify data processing and analysis workflows, facilitating collaboration for data professionals. Databricks offers an integrated environment for data scientists, engineers, and business analysts, streamlining the process of building and deploying AI and data-driven applications. With a strong emphasis on simplifying big data management, Databricks helps businesses harness the power of their data to drive innovation and insights.
